Planning Office: Request for Execution of Deed to Town for Parcel of Land Formerly Part of Nonantum Avenue As Shown on Plan Entitled “Plan For Discontinuance of a Portion of Nonantum Avenue Prepared for the Town of Nantucket in Nantucket, MA”, Dated July 20, 2009, Prepared by Nantucket Surveyors, LLC, and Recorded with Nantucket County Registry of Deeds as Plan No. 2009- 39, Pursuant to Chapter 89 of the Acts of 2011. Planning Director Andrew Vorce reviewed a map of the area at Nonantum Avenue, noting that a Home Rule Petition to give the land to the Town was approved at two town meetings before being passed by state legislation. He added that this parcel will join other Town-owned beach parcels. Mr. DeCosta moved to execute the deed to the Town for a parcel of land formerly part of Nonantum Avenue, as presented; Mr. Willauer seconded. So voted 4-0. 2. R. Thomas Okonak and James R.
